Output ec56a03c35edf3061db4f4016ff0007e845a878dfe236e5310b809a93df105cb:0

value
2636423
script pubkey
OP_0 OP_PUSHBYTES_20 a8d75cb9e6c05406cc7e2cf69b72493c5b368be4
address
bc1q4rt4ew0xcp2qdnr79nmfkujf83dndzlynqy3kz
transaction
ec56a03c35edf3061db4f4016ff0007e845a878dfe236e5310b809a93df105cb
spent
true